全新世大暖期对青藏高原东北缘人类活动的影响 被引量:5

结合环境演变资料与考古发现,全新世大暖期暖湿的气候条件,促进了青藏高原东北缘古文化的发展。表现在:随着全新世大暖期暖湿环境的到来,人类活动强度大大增强;细石器文化活动模式发生显著改变,由晚更新世末期一全新世早期的短暂... 结合环境演变资料与考古发现,全新世大暖期暖湿的气候条件,促进了青藏高原东北缘古文化的发展。表现在:随着全新世大暖期暖湿环境的到来,人类活动强度大大增强;细石器文化活动模式发生显著改变,由晚更新世末期一全新世早期的短暂宿营式居住模式演变为相对固定的聚落模式;暖期中较好的水热条件,刺激了仰韶、马家窑文化在本区东部河谷地区的扩张,在暖期的6~4kaBP形成了东部河谷地带马家窑文化,西部高原细石器文化并存的区系格局,两种文化体系在共存中交流,在交流中高原细石器文化掌握了农业种植、使用了陶器,全面推动了高原土著文化进入新石器。 展开更多

Deep Learning for Real-Time Crime Forecasting and Its Ternarization 被引量:2

Real-time crime forecasting is important.However,accurate prediction of when and where the next crime will happen is difficult.No known physical model provides a reasonable approximation to such a complex system.Historical crime data are sparse in both space and time and the signal of interests is weak.In this work,the authors first present a proper representation of crime data.The authors then adapt the spatial temporal residual network on the well represented data to predict the distribution of crime in Los Angeles at the scale of hours in neighborhood-sized parcels.These experiments as well as comparisons with several existing approaches to prediction demonstrate the superiority of the proposed model in terms of accuracy.Finally,the authors present a ternarization technique to address the resource consumption issue for its deployment in real world.This work is an extension of our short conference proceeding paper[Wang,B.,Zhang,D.,Zhang,D.H.,et al.,Deep learning for real time Crime forecasting,2017,ar Xiv:1707.03340]. 展开更多
